Day 8: Orkas Island

The shipwrecked company had no time to answer indiglo’s question, which was their own also. They were dazed, and baffled by their profound misfortune.

“I would bet anything MovingPictures07 is responsible for our crash. That tempest did not seem natural. Where is he?” said AceofSpaces.

But MovingPictures07 was nowhere to be seen on the beach, neither within the wreckage nor noticed among the trees.

“Maybe he was cast out of the airship over the jungle like indiglo,” Elohcin said. “If he is the cause of our trouble, then it would be unwise to seek him out.”

“To think we were nearly home,” someone replied distantly.

The sound of a horn startled everyone.

A band of beastly figures appeared on the edge of the trees. Weapons in hand, they appeared ready to descend upon the beach and bathe the sand in blood.

“Karikoni!” someone cried. “Prepare to defend yourselves!”

The hideous growl of one of the Karikoni dozen cut through the air. “I am Pinsore, the ruler of Orkas Island and cousin to the slain Clawful. How unfortunate that you should crash here! We have some work for you. Do not resist us!”

A rebellious but obviously weary voice cried, “We will not be slaves to the Karikoni!”

“You will,” Pinsore said. “When you’ve been pinched in every place imaginable, you will beg for the fate that we now offer you peaceably.”

“Never!”

“Then you only increase calamity for yourselves.”

The Karikoni, crustacean warriors, ruddy and belligerent, stormed down the to the beach, prepared to enslave the wounded strewn along it.

“We must swim. We have no choice!” a desperate voice announced.

Seeing sand dunes in the distance, each member of the party threw themselves into the water.

But DFaraday, whose left leg was already injured from the crash, found his right leg in the massive chela of one of the Karikoni cohort before he could reach the waves. The pincer’s teeth bore into his upper thigh, tearing into his flesh while crushing the muscle within. DFaraday heard the bone in his thigh crack and he screamed. His vision dimmed.

A guttural moan came from the attacking beast, and the pressure died away. When he looked again, DFaraday saw his assailant knocked out, but his vision was blurry, and he could not see his rescuer.

“Come. I have the strength to carry you.”

DFaraday shrieked as his legs, the right one a bloody remnant of a limb, were plunged into the saltwater. He fell unconscious as someone carried him across the strait.

Day 9: The Sands of Time

Heaving sea water that seemed to weigh heavily in their lungs, the company fell upon sand that had been warmed all day by the afternoon sun, but was just starting to cool down again.

For a long time, DFaraday was unresponsive save for his labored breathing.

And everyone saw MovingPictures07 observing them from a distance, perfectly dry, his long hair flowing in the wind. Most of the swimmers wanted to smite him then and there, but their muscles protested at the slightest movement.

Unlike Orkas Island, there were no trees in this region to shield them from a sun that had weighed hotly upon them all day, and even in what seemed to be a lifeless desert, they were grateful for the forthcoming night.

Some instinct- or perhaps the realization that the Karikoni might be watching them, preparing to advance on them again- made them force themselves inland.

After they traversed a fourth sand dune, and the sun was half hidden by the horizon, they beheld a radiant figure, who was chanting.

“Nothing has permanence.” The syllables folded in upon themselves with a resonance that made the sentence soon sound like one harmonic tone. Her words seemed to be lifted by the arid wind, and echoed as though they defied time itself. The air was fused with a hypnotic element.

“Who are you?” someone moaned.

The humming and the radiance fell away, and she regarded the group as though she had not noticed them up until that point.

“I am Zanthora, daughter of Zanthor the Cosmic Enforcer.”

A silence followed as she regarded all of them. And then she said, “You are not whom you appear to be, are you? None of you are. You are strangers to one another. Yet nothing has permanence, not even strangeness. Take comfort in this.” And then she said, “If you will perform a task for me, I will perform a task for you. The Sands of Time inform me also that your party is not whole. The Sands of Time tell me that many of you have been lost along the way. The Sands of Time say that my father’s enemy, Skeletor the deceiver has been responsible for many deaths, and that his former professor, Hodak, has been responsible for many more. The sands see this.”

Zanthora’s eyes had been drawn closed as she uttered much of this, but then they flicked open with a sudden resolve. “The Sands of Time have given me the authority to release one whom you lost to Snake Mountain or The Horde from the bonds of death, for nothing has permanence, not even death! Yes! And in return for this life, this companion of yours, you will journey to the Ruins of Zalesia, from whence my father came, and you will make a sacrifice there. For nothing has permanence, not even life! No! And with this blood sacrifice, I may be free. For I am at once prisoner and priestess of these sands. And ephemerality, purchased by blood, is my only salvation.”

A puzzled silence came over the austere desert.

The aural alterations returned.

“Nothing has permanence.”
